Nullscape Curse Tier List
The easiest Curses to counter in Nullscape, and the most difficult.
S Tier
LAP 2
Appears from level 8How it Works:
Collapse is slowerBefore the Beacon spawns, you can spawn the Altar of Purgatory with the Altar of Echo (For more info, I’ve written a Nullscape Altars guide)
Golden Gifts gathered from the Altar of Purgatory increase by 1.33x
The Beacon appears after 40% of the Golden Gifts have been picked up, unless all the tiles disappear
Mart Infection
Exclusive to MartAppears from level 1How it Works:
Temporary Marts appear around the Beacon whenever a player is defeated
A Tier
Nothing?
Appears from level 8How it Works:
Shop items are 15% cheaperEvery 5 levels, an additional entity spawns
Bigger Tripmines
Appears from level 5How it Works:
Tripmines are 10% larger
Jackpot
Appears from level 12How it Works:
The Altar of Chance spawns at the start of the level
Concussion
Exclusive to BellAppears from level 1How it Works:
You cannot jump for 7 seconds after ringing the Bell
Closer Husk
Exclusive to HuskAppears from level 1How it Works:
Husks spawn faster after the cue
Taller Husk
Exclusive to HuskAppears from level 1How it Works:
Husks are 50% taller
Bloodier Meat
Exclusive to FleshAppears from level 5How it Works:
Flesh can infect tiles at a greater range
Accurate Telefragger
Exclusive to TelefraggerAppears from level ?How it Works:
The chance of it teleporting to a player depends on their momentum
Blade Carousel
Exclusive to VoidbreakerAppears from level ?How it Works:
Its swords spin around players before striking
Deadly Melody
Exclusive to CadenceAppears from level ?How it Works:
Whenever a player is defeated, an instrument spawns
Blueprint: Cross Beams
Exclusive to ScrapmawAppears from level ?How it Works:
An extra row of lasers can be summoned
B Tier
High Roller
Appears from level 5How it Works:
The Altar of Chance has different effects
Tweaked Odds
Appears from level 5How it Works:
When using the Altar of Chance, you are inflicted with Positive and Negative effects
Fake Count
Appears from level 8How it Works:
You cannot see the number of Gifts you’ve picked up
Barotrauma
Appears from level 15How it Works:
Seamines are 20% largerThe knockback from Seamines is stronger
Minefield
Appears from level 10How it Works:
There are 50% more Seamines
Fragile Gifts
Appears from level 8How it Works:
Collapse is much fasterYou obtain 0.75x more Golden Gifts
Mart Slide
Exclusive to MartAppears from level 1How it Works:
Mart’s speed passively increases
Bigger Marts
Exclusive to MartAppears from level 1How it Works:
Marts are 1.5x larger
Scorched Earth
Exclusive to ICBMAppears from level 1How it Works:
After exploding, a pool of fire is left behind, which moves the player forward for 7 seconds upon contact
Further Husk
Exclusive to HuskAppears from level 1How it Works:
Husks are 1.6 seconds behind players
Random Husk
Exclusive to HuskAppears from level 15How it Works:
The distance between a player and a Husk randomly increases and decreases
Springloaded
Exclusive to SpringerAppears from level 5How it Works:
After Springer jumps, a shockwave is summoned
Resonating Shockwaves
Exclusive to SpringerAppears from level 5How it Works:
Getting hit by a shockwave inflicts players with Overtuned, which instantly defeats them when they ring the Bell
Blighted Jump Pads
Exclusive to FleshAppears from level ?How it Works:
Grapple Points and Jump Pads can be infected
Ambush
Exclusive to TelefraggerAppears from level 8How it Works:
There is a 20% chance of it spawning behind a player instead of in front of them
If it spawns behind a player, it is 2x faster for 1.5 seconds
Burning Banquet
Exclusive to KolonaAppears from level ?How it Works:
When Kolona spawns, so too does Razorbloom
C Tier
Random Spawn
Appears from level 1How it Works:
Players and entities are teleported to a random location on the map
Weaker Jump Pads
Appears from level 1How it Works:
Jump Pads are 25% weakerGrapple Points are 40% weaker
Beacon Mirage
Appears from level 25How it Works:
Fake Beacons spawn during CollapseThe real Beacon changes location
Pacifier
Exclusive to Baby and Voidbound BabyAppears from level 1How it Works:
Audio cues and visual cues are less effective when Baby or Voidbound baby are nearby
Bigger Blast
Exclusive to ICBMAppears from level 5How it Works:
The radius is increased
Husk Express
Exclusive to HuskAppears from level 8How it Works:
A barrier appears in front of the Husk, which can make contact with the player, leading to instant defeat
Shotgun
Exclusive to Guardians and Voidbound GuardiansAppears from level 5How it Works:
They can now shoot twice with 8 bulletsThey now deal AoE DMG
D Tier
Lower Gravity
Appears from level 1How it Works:
Your jumping height increases
Savory Ring
Appears from level 5How it Works:
Extra entities are added during CollapseGolden Gifts are increased by 0.15x
Scattered Gifts
Appears from level 1How it Works:
Gifts and Golden Gifts move within 2 studs
More Tripmines
Appears from level 5How it Works:
There are 2x more TripminesFewer Gifts spawn
More Ringing
Exclusive to BellAppears from level 1How it Works:
Enemies can ring the BellBell can teleport more often
Mighty Gong
Exclusive to BellAppears from level 1How it Works:
Bell increases in size each time it teleports, summoning a shockwave
Problem Child
Exclusive to Baby and Voidbound BabyAppears from level 5How it Works:
Baby and Voidbound Baby can feint, changing their route with increased speed
Conga Line
Exclusive to HuskAppears from level 10How it Works:
The number of Husks which spawn increases by 3x
Cognitive Dissonance
Exclusive to NILAppears from level ?How it Works:
NIL chases the same player that it has attacked four timesDuring the chase, fake NIL entities are spawnedThe player is inflicted with the Insanity debuff, which causes hallucinations
Camouflage
Exclusive to Guardians and Voidbound GuardiansAppears from level 5How it Works:
They turn invisible whenever they moveThe speed of their bullets increases
Lost Embers
Exclusive to KolonaAppears from level ?How it Works:
Players must rely on cues instead of being able to see the displayed number
